Dams are large structures built across rivers or streams to regulate the flow of water, store water for various purposes, and generate hydroelectric power. They consist of a solid barrier, usually made of concrete or earth, that obstructs the natural flow of water.

Here's how dams help in conserving and managing water:

  1. Water Storage: Dams store water during times of excess flow, such as during heavy rainfall or snowmelt. This stored water can then be released during periods of drought or increased demand for irrigation, drinking water, or industrial use.

  2. Flood Control: Dams help mitigate the risk of flooding by regulating the flow of water downstream. They can hold back excess water during times of heavy rainfall or rapid snowmelt, preventing downstream areas from being inundated.

  3. Hydropower Generation: Many dams are equipped with turbines that harness the energy of flowing water to generate electricity. This renewable energy source, known as hydropower, is clean and sustainable, helping to reduce reliance on fossil fuels.

  4. Irrigation: Dams provide water for irrigation, allowing farmers to cultivate crops even during dry seasons. By storing and releasing water as needed, dams support agricultural productivity and food security.

  5. Recreation and Tourism: Reservoirs created by dams often offer opportunities for recreational activities such as boating, fishing, swimming, and camping. These reservoirs can also attract tourists, boosting local economies.

  6. Water Supply: Dams supply water for domestic, industrial, and municipal purposes. The stored water can be treated and distributed to communities for drinking, sanitation, and other uses.

  7. Ecosystem Management: Dams can have both positive and negative impacts on ecosystems. While they can disrupt natural river flow and fish migration routes, they also create new habitats and recreational areas. Proper management strategies, such as fish ladders and environmental flow releases, can help mitigate these impacts and maintain ecological balance.

Overall, dams play a crucial role in water resource management by regulating water flow, providing various benefits to society, and supporting economic development and environmental sustainability. However, it's essential to consider their potential environmental and social impacts and implement appropriate mitigation measures.
